What I mean is the type of set that once it is brushed out it leaves hair in that beautiful bouncy, wavy/curly shape. I tried to do it this morning but my hair looks like a poofball. I call it an "old lady set" because I always see those sharp older women wearing it. It's not really a "young" style. Any suggestions?
 
My mom gets that set by wet setting and air drying thoroughly (usually all day or overnight). When she takes the rollers down she applies a heavy grease (a dime size amount) in her palms and runs through her hair. Then she brushes and the curls are set. She uses a bonnet at night and her bouncy curls last about a week. I think the main thing is to make sure it is completely dry before taking the rollers down.
